STOP PRESS NEWS

TEST CRICKET SOUTH AFRICAN TEAM JOHANNESBURG. Feb. 13. The following team has been selected to represent South Africa against the M.C.C. team in the fourth Test match which will open on Friday. A. .Melville (captain), B. Mitchell, A. R. Nourse. K. C. Vilfoen, E. A. Rowan, Van de Bijl, E. L. Dalton, A. B. Langton, N. Gordon, A. Newson, W.
